This initiative marks the third consecutive year of collaboration between J&T Express and Ejan. The donated items included bicycles, school supplies, and educational toys, aiming to expand access to educational resources for underprivileged children in remote areas. Leveraging its nationwide logistics network, J&T Express ensured the timely, secure, and efficient delivery of all donated items.

As a sustainability-driven company deeply rooted in Thailand, J&T Express integrates its logistics capabilities with a long-term commitment to education and youth development. Past initiatives include the 2024 donation of multimedia equipment for a sensory classroom at a special education school in Prachuap Khiri Khan Province, and the 2025 contribution to the Mirror Foundation's "Computers for Children" program, which provided computers, CPUs, monitors, and printers to support digital learning opportunities for youth.
